Gauge-invariant rotor Hamiltonian from dual variables of 3D gauge theory

Abstract
We present a tensor formulation for free compact electrodynamics in three Euclidean dimensions and use this formulation to construct a quantum Hamiltonian in the continuous-time limit. Gauge-invariance is maintained at every step and ultimately the gauge fields are integrated out, removing all initial gauge freedom. The resulting Hamiltonian can be written as a rotor model. The energy eigenvalues for this Hamiltonian are computed using the tensor renormalization group, and are compared with perturbation theory. We find good agreement between the calculations, demonstrating a smooth passage from the statistical lattice Lagrangian description to the quantum Hamiltonian description.
